Quantitative characterization of the global electrophilicity power of common diene/dienophile pairs in Diels-Alder reactions
Abstract
The global electrophilicity power, ω, of a series of dienes and dienophiles commonly used in Diels-Alder reactions may be conveniently classified within a unique relative scale. Useful information about the polarity of transition state structures expected for a given reaction may be obtained from the difference in the global electrophilicity power, Δω, of the diene/dienophile interacting pair. Thus the polarity of the process can be related with non-polar (Δω small, pericyclic processes) and polar (Δω big, ionic processes) mechanisms. © 2002 Elsevier Science Ltd. All rights reserved.
